What You Should Do

 

-Stay informed – CDC is updating its website daily with the latest information and advice for the public. (https://www.cdc.gov/coronavirus/2019-ncov/community/organizations/cleaning-disinfection.html)

-Remember to take everyday preventive actions that are always recommended to prevent the spread of respiratory viruses.
     -Avoid close contact with sick people.
     -While sick, limit contact with others as much as possible and  stay home if you are sick.
     -Cover your nose and mouth when you cough or sneeze. Avoid touching your eyes, nose and mouth. Germs spread this way.
     -Clean and disinfect surfaces and objects that may be contaminated with germs.
     -Wash your hands often with soap and water for at least 20 seconds. If soap and water are not available, use an alcohol-based hand rub with at least 60% alcohol.

-If you feel sick with fever, cough, or difficulty breathing, and have traveled to China or were in close contact with someone with 2019-nCoV in the 14 days before you began to feel sick, seek medical care. Before you go to a doctor’s office or emergency room, call ahead and tell them about your recent travel and your symptoms.

What is Janitronics Building Services doing regarding cleaning and disinfecting activities?

-Day Cleaning staff (if staffed) are using disinfectant solutions during the regular daily cleaning of all restrooms and in the first-floor building entrance lobbies, all doors, door handles and knobs, elevator buttons and panels, and other commonly touched areas.

-Evening Cleaning Staff are using disinfectant solutions on entrance lobby doors, door handles and knobs, elevator buttons and panels, kitchenettes, restrooms and internal stair railings.

 

Will Janitronics Building Services provide additional cleaning services within tenant space?

-Yes, we will provide additional services at a tenant’s request.  However, any cleaning services beyond the building standard will be a billable work order to the tenant.  This will exclude personal space/desks/cubicles/computers/keyboards. These spaces will be the responsibility of the occupant.

-If suspected or confirmed exposure of 2019-nCoV occurred within the building, any special cleaning services will be provided under the guidance and specific direction of the local public health department which may include using our service partner Belfor.
